Q. When Epidemius’ tally reaches 20+ casualtiesthe rules say that ‘All attacks from followers ofNurgle ignore armor saves’. Was this intendedto affect both ranged and close combat attacksby the followers of Nurgle, as the text seemsto indicate?A. Yes, that is indeed the case. Both ranged andclose combat attacks.
